Wafu - I think I love you

Wafu LINE SHOT Bottle Mocks Canadian 290mL
Healthy, tasty and versatile - what's not to like?


I’ve been having fun playing with a new line of Japanese vinaigrettes called Wafu. They come in four flavours; original, original light, carrot-ginger and wasabi edamane. You can use them for marinating, dressing, or dipping. I love the carrot-ginger on barbequed salmon or chicken, or drizzled on a salad of fresh lettuce, sliced green apple, dried cranberries and toasted almonds. I also used the wasabi-edamane as a substitute for mustard in a quick vinaigrette. Wafu 290mL GC
Look on the website for a recipe for a Caesar salad (all the fun without the fat!) made with the original version. These are cooking shortcuts you can feel good about – they have no added colours, artificial flavours, trans fats, are low in cholesterol and  saturated fat – and they’re kosher. They promise to launch a gluten-free version soon. Check them out online for where and how to buy, or visit their Facebook page. Love this stuff!
